Wiring basics: connecting lights to the truck’s electrical system safely
Wiring chicken lights to your truck’s electrical system isn’t just about aesthetics—it’s about functionality and safety. The truck’s electrical system operates on a 12-volt DC circuit, and any accessory, including chicken lights, must integrate seamlessly without overloading the system. Start by identifying the power source: most installations tap into the truck’s battery or a dedicated accessory fuse in the fuse box. Always use a relay to handle the current draw, as direct wiring to the switch can melt wires or blow fuses. This foundational step ensures the lights operate efficiently without compromising the truck’s electrical integrity.
Analyzing the wiring process reveals common pitfalls. One frequent mistake is underestimating wire gauge. Chicken lights, especially LED strips, draw minimal current, but the wire length matters. For runs longer than 10 feet, use 16-gauge wire to minimize voltage drop. Another critical aspect is grounding. A poor ground connection can cause flickering or failure. Always connect the ground wire directly to the truck’s chassis or a clean metal surface, avoiding paint or rust. These details may seem minor, but they’re the difference between a reliable setup and a frustrating failure.
Persuasively, investing in quality components pays off. Waterproof connectors, fused wiring harnesses, and heat-shrink tubing aren’t optional—they’re essential. Moisture intrusion is a leading cause of electrical failures in vehicles, and chicken lights, often mounted externally, are particularly vulnerable. A fused harness protects the circuit from overcurrent, while heat-shrink tubing seals connections against the elements. Skimping on these components might save a few dollars upfront but can lead to costly repairs or safety hazards down the road.

Waterproofing connections to protect wiring from outdoor conditions
Outdoor wiring, especially for truck-mounted chicken lights, faces relentless exposure to moisture, temperature extremes, and debris. Water intrusion can corrode connections, short circuits, and render your lighting system inoperable. Protecting these vulnerable points is crucial for longevity and safety.
One effective method is using heat-shrink tubing. This pliable plastic shrinks tightly around connections when heated, creating a watertight seal. Choose tubing with a 2:1 shrink ratio and a diameter slightly larger than your wire bundle. After making your connection, slide the tubing over the wires, ensuring it covers the entire exposed area. Apply heat evenly with a heat gun or hairdryer until the tubing conforms snugly.
Silicone sealant offers another robust waterproofing solution. Opt for a high-quality, outdoor-rated silicone specifically designed for electrical applications. Apply a generous bead around the base of each connection, smoothing it with a gloved finger or a small tool. Allow ample curing time as per the manufacturer's instructions before exposing the wiring to the elements.
While heat-shrink tubing and silicone sealant are popular choices, consider environmental factors. In areas with extreme cold, silicone's flexibility may be advantageous over potentially brittle heat-shrink. Conversely, in hot climates, heat-shrink's resistance to UV degradation might be preferable.

Testing and troubleshooting common issues with chicken coop light setups
Once your chicken coop lights are wired to your truck, testing and troubleshooting become critical to ensure functionality and safety. Begin by verifying all connections are secure and insulated to prevent shorts or electrical fires. Use a multimeter to check for continuity across the circuit, ensuring power flows from the truck’s battery to the lights without interruption. If the lights fail to turn on, inspect the fuse or circuit breaker in the truck’s electrical system, as a blown fuse is a common culprit. Always disconnect the battery before handling wiring to avoid shocks or damage.
A frequent issue with chicken coop light setups is dim or flickering lights, often caused by voltage drop due to insufficient wire gauge. For runs longer than 10 feet, use 12-gauge wire to minimize power loss. If the lights still flicker, test the ground connection—a poor ground can disrupt the circuit. Connect the multimeter’s negative lead to the truck’s chassis and the positive lead to the light’s ground wire; a significant voltage difference indicates a grounding issue. Tighten all ground connections and clean corrosion from terminals to resolve this.
Water intrusion is another common problem, especially in outdoor setups. Inspect all wiring and connectors for moisture, which can corrode components and cause intermittent failures. Seal connections with waterproof heat shrink tubing or silicone sealant. If lights malfunction after exposure to rain, dry the wiring thoroughly and replace any damaged components. Consider installing a waterproof switch and fuse box near the battery to protect the system from the elements.
Finally, test the light’s timer or switch mechanism to ensure it operates as intended. Mechanical timers can fail over time, while digital timers may reset after power outages. Simulate a full cycle by manually turning the lights on and off, checking for responsiveness. If the timer fails, replace it with a heavy-duty model rated for outdoor use. Regularly inspect the entire setup monthly to catch issues early, especially before seasons with extreme weather.
